Anti-racism education and ... WebMar 16, 2024 · Sometimes prejudice develops in response to historical events. An example of this is holding negative beliefs against all Muslims as a result of the attacks that took place on September 11, 2001. This is known as Islamaphobia and still impacts Muslim Americans today. 8.
